Refugees United Foundation Usa
Refugees United Foundation Usa reported paying David Troensegaard, Treasurer, $64,702 in total compensation (FY 2024).
That places David Troensegaard at approximately the 64th percentile among 33 similarly sized international affairs nonprofits (median $40,000).
